HPLC Analysis of Phenolic Acids and Antioxidant Activity of Some Classical Ayurvedic Guggulu Formulations

Abstract: Classical guggulu formulations have been used as mainstay therapeutics in chronic inflammatory diseases in Ayurvedic system of medicine since centuries. The present study included six guggulu formulations such as Kaishora guggulu, Kanchanara guggulu, Yogaraj guggulu, Punrnava guggulu, Amritadi guggulu and Trayodasanga guggulu.Phenolic compounds play a vital role as evident from phenolic and flavonoid content in guggulu drugs as well as antioxidant activity assayed by DPPH radical scavenging activity and FRAP a… Show more

“…These are sub-classified as benzoic acid and cinnamic acid backbone structure containing seven (C6-C1) and nine (C6-C3) carbon atoms, respectively. Hydroxybenzoic acid derivatives such as gallic acid, syringic acid and cinnamic acid derivatives like caffeic acid, chlorogenic acid, sinapic acid, p-coumaric acid are widely available in plants 33 , 34 , 59 , 60 . Masek et al ., concluded that caffeic acid is the predominantly and widely available phenolic acid, and it exhibits antioxidant and iron-chelating abilities which are better than p coumaric acid 61 .…”
